Abstract
Three carbon precursors (viz. pyrrole, aniline and phenanthroline) were impregnated in the mesoporous silica nanoflower (MSNF) template, which was found to yield considerable effect on the morphology of the derived carbon materials (NCNF). The derived NCNF catalysts present the excellent ORR performance as the metal-free catalyst. The optimal catalyst, NCNF-PHEN-900, outperform the Pt/C catalyst with 30-mV halfwave potential (E1/2) surpassing in alkaline media, while in the acidic media, NCNF-PHEN-900 (E1/2 = 0.76 V) exhibit a comparable activity to Pt/C, suggesting it one of the best for metal-free catalysts used for ORR.250
